410 institutional managers reported holding MWA in 13F filings for the quarter ended 2026-03-31. Together they hold about 93% of the company; the top 10 hold 52%. 60 opened new positions that quarter. Held by BlackRock, Vanguard Group, State Street, among others. On the short side, 4.2M shares were sold short as of the 2026-06-15 count, about 3% of shares outstanding (3.6 days of typical volume to cover).

MWA has cut its share count 1.3% over the past five years, spending $85.50M on repurchases. It pays a dividend, and has paid one every year in our records (17 and counting), raised 6 years straight; the current rate is $0.27 a share annually. Cash returned over the past three years: $113.20M in dividends and $40.50M in repurchases.
